AFC Wimbledon sign QPR striker Sutherland

AFC Wimbledon have snapped up QPR striker Frankie Sutherland.

The 20-year-old, who is yet to make a senior appearance for QPR, will be with the League Two side until 29 November.

Sutherland had a spell on loan at Leyton Orient last season but his time in east London was cut short by a serious injury on his debut.

He is eligible to play in both the FA Cup and Johnstone's Paint Trophy competitions for the Dons.

"Frankie is a player we have monitored for the last six months, since he came back from his injury," Wimbledon boss Neal Ardley told the club website.

"He is a strong, combative midfielder, an intelligent passer of the ball and we have seen his fitness and influence on games grow throughout the season."
